SqlServices.InstallSessionState 方法

定義

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

多載

InstallSessionState(String, String, SessionStateType)

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

InstallSessionState(String, SessionStateType, String)

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

InstallSessionState(String, String, String, String, SessionStateType)

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

InstallSessionState(String, String, SessionStateType)

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

public:
 static void InstallSessionState(System::String ^ server, System::String ^ customDatabase, System::Web::Management::SessionStateType type);
public static void InstallSessionState (string server, string customDatabase, System.Web.Management.SessionStateType type);
static member InstallSessionState : string * string * System.Web.Management.SessionStateType -> unit
Public Shared Sub InstallSessionState (server As String, customDatabase As String, type As SessionStateType)

參數

server
String

要安裝工作階段狀態元件的 SQL Server 執行個體。

customDatabase
String

要安裝工作階段狀態元件的資料庫。

type
SessionStateType

其中一個 SessionStateType 值,指定要安裝的工作階段狀態類型。

例外狀況

類型是 Custom 且未提供 customDatabase 值,或類型是 TemporaryPersistedcustomDatabase 值不為 null。

無法連接至指定的資料庫伺服器。

處理作業所需要的 SQL 陳述式時,會發生例外狀況。

範例

下列程式碼範例示範如何使用 InstallSessionState 類別的 SqlServices 方法。

// Install temporary session state.
SqlServices.InstallSessionState(server, null,
    SessionStateType.Temporary);
' Install temporary session state.
SqlServices.InstallSessionState(server, Nothing, _
    SessionStateType.Temporary)

備註

如果 servernull 或未提供, SqlServices 則會使用預設的 SQL Server 實例。

注意

與資料庫伺服器的連線是使用受信任的連接所建立。

另請參閱

適用於

InstallSessionState(String, SessionStateType, String)

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

public:
 static void InstallSessionState(System::String ^ customDatabase, System::Web::Management::SessionStateType type, System::String ^ connectionString);
public static void InstallSessionState (string customDatabase, System.Web.Management.SessionStateType type, string connectionString);
static member InstallSessionState : string * System.Web.Management.SessionStateType * string -> unit
Public Shared Sub InstallSessionState (customDatabase As String, type As SessionStateType, connectionString As String)

參數

customDatabase
String

要安裝工作階段狀態元件的資料庫。

type
SessionStateType

其中一個 SessionStateType 值,指定要安裝的工作階段狀態類型。

connectionString
String

要使用的連接字串。 此連接字串只用來建立資料庫伺服器的連接。 在連接字串中指定資料庫是沒有作用的。

例外狀況

類型是 Custom 且未提供 customDatabase 值,或類型是 TemporaryPersistedcustomDatabase 值不為 null。

無法連接至指定的資料庫伺服器。

處理作業所需要的 SQL 陳述式時,會發生例外狀況。

範例

下列程式碼範例示範如何使用 InstallSessionState(String, SessionStateType, String) 類別的 SqlServices 方法。

// Install a custom session state database.
SqlServices.InstallSessionState(database,
    SessionStateType.Custom,
    connectionString);
' Install a custom session state database.
SqlServices.InstallSessionState(database, _
    SessionStateType.Custom, _
    connectionString)

另請參閱

適用於

InstallSessionState(String, String, String, String, SessionStateType)

在 SQL Server 資料庫上安裝 ASP.NET 工作階段狀態的元件。

public:
 static void InstallSessionState(System::String ^ server, System::String ^ user, System::String ^ password, System::String ^ customDatabase, System::Web::Management::SessionStateType type);
public static void InstallSessionState (string server, string user, string password, string customDatabase, System.Web.Management.SessionStateType type);
static member InstallSessionState : string * string * string * string * System.Web.Management.SessionStateType -> unit
Public Shared Sub InstallSessionState (server As String, user As String, password As String, customDatabase As String, type As SessionStateType)

參數

server
String

要安裝工作階段狀態元件的 SQL Server 執行個體。

user
String

連接至資料庫時使用的使用者名稱。

password
String

連接至資料庫時使用的密碼。

customDatabase
String

要安裝工作階段狀態元件的資料庫。

type
SessionStateType

其中一個 SessionStateType 值,指定要安裝的工作階段狀態類型。

例外狀況

類型是 Custom 且未提供 customDatabase 值,或類型是 TemporaryPersistedcustomDatabase 值不為 null。

無法連接至指定的資料庫伺服器。

處理作業所需要的 SQL 陳述式時,會發生例外狀況。

範例

下列程式碼範例示範如何使用 InstallSessionState(String, String, String, String, SessionStateType) 類別的 SqlServices 方法。

// Install persisted session state.
SqlServices.InstallSessionState(server, user, password,
    null, SessionStateType.Persisted);
' Install persisted session state.
SqlServices.InstallSessionState(server, user, password, _
    Nothing, SessionStateType.Persisted)

備註

如果 servernull 或未提供, SqlServices 則會使用預設的 SQL Server 實例。

注意

與資料庫伺服器的連線是使用受信任的連接所建立。

另請參閱

適用於